The stuff you level up for after matches. How much does it take for each level?
From my tests before hand it follows the same formula as the hero levels.
(CurrentLevel+1)*100

Well NomesWisdom, I forgot to mention those variables weren't in the game_settings.cfg file before Matchmaking, so I can only assume that those values were placed in there for the Matchmaking ladder leveling system.
Though it is possible that it's put in there due to the addition of casual mode, but then the easy mode variable would have existed in it (which it didn't before).
Therefore the logical conclusion is that those variables define the leveling thresholds for the MM account system.
